sqlsrv_configure

(No version information available, might only be in Git)

sqlsrv_configureCambia la configuración de los drivers del gestionador de errores y de log

Descripción

sqlsrv_configure(string $setting, mixed $value): bool

Cambia la configuración de los drivers del gestionador de errores y de log.

Parámetros

setting

El nombre de la propiedad a configurar. Los valores posibles son "WarningsReturnAsErrors", "LogSubsystems", and "LogSeverity".

value

El valor de la propiedad especificada. La tabla siguiente muestra los valores posibles:

Opciones de configuración de la gestión de errores y log
Propiedades Opciones
WarningsReturnAsErrors 1 (true) or 0 (false)
LogSubsystems SQLSRV_LOG_SYSTEM_ALL (-1) SQLSRV_LOG_SYSTEM_CONN (2) SQLSRV_LOG_SYSTEM_INIT (1) SQLSRV_LOG_SYSTEM_OFF (0) SQLSRV_LOG_SYSTEM_STMT (4) SQLSRV_LOG_SYSTEM_UTIL (8)
LogSeverity SQLSRV_LOG_SEVERITY_ALL (-1) SQLSRV_LOG_SEVERITY_ERROR (1) SQLSRV_LOG_SEVERITY_NOTICE (4) SQLSRV_LOG_SEVERITY_WARNING (2)

Valores devueltos

Devuelve true en caso de éxito o false en caso de error.

add a note

User Contributed Notes 1 note

up
-11
smhahmadi
11 years ago
Performance tip:

Beware of the performance penalty involved with unchecked use of logging options. In my case, although I was using the buffered cursor, sqlsrv_fetch_array was running too slowly. The solution was to remove my lavish use of those configuration options (using both SQLSRV_LOG_SYSTEM_ALL and SQLSRV_LOG_SEVERITY_ALL).
To Top